Some people find the Magnex to be a little too quiet, I know I did.
The ScoobySport exhausts are liked very much by the peeps on this BBS, I ran one for a while, v nice noise.... but not loud enough for me...
HKS Hiper is the next step up from scoobysport in terms of volume, the loudest on the market as far as I am aware is the BPM Twister3 Backbox
I have owned each of these exhausts, my fave is the HKS Hiper, fantastic noise, great power increases, pops, bangs and flames
The one I most enjoyed was the BPM, it is nothing short of breathtaking!!!! I just LOVE the noise it made.... everyone else didnt though!

blackbeast (MY94 WRX Wagon) has a loud, but throaty sound, it's running a BPM Twindump downpipe, connected to a Apexi N1 center and backbox combo, 3" all the way through. Like I said, loud, but throaty.
